Thomas Piketty: "Capital and Ideology"


Few academic books ever become bestsellers, and even fewer dramatically change global political discussions. Prof. Piketty’s Capital in the 21st Century (2013) did both. The book traced the history of income and wealth inequality in the developed world, arguing that inequality is an important feature – and not an accident- of capitalism. Most importantly, his work brought economic inequality back to the centre of political discussion. It was an honour to have Professor Piketty join us for the second time at Room for Discussion! This time the topic of the interview was his newest book: Capital and Ideology (2019). In this new work, he argues from a historical and global perspective that inequality is not economic or technological, it is ideological and political. As such, it is fundamentally founded in the battle of ideas. The interview discusses these views and more, offering a short but insightful summary of over 1000 pages of Piketty's craft.
